Instructional Designer

Bee Talent Solutions, Seattle, WA, United States

We are seeking a talented Instructional Designer with expertise in learning technology to join our Client. The ideal candidate will be responsible for designing and developing engaging and effective learning experiences using a variety of technologies and methodologies. Success in this role requires ownership, urgency, and deep curiosity to understand the needs of the business and improve how we develop employees to execute our business strategy and achieve the client's ambitious goals.

This role is fundamentally about thriving in a growing and changing environment, focusing on the future, and being able to think strategically yet operate tactically when required. The individual successful in this role will have a proven track record of designing and developing enablement programs globally. You will be working in a cross-functional role that requires collaboration, a deep understanding of instructional design and technology-enabled learning tools and methodologies, and demonstrated ability to partner effectively with all levels of stakeholders

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ate with subject matter experts (SMEs) including People Partners, peers, and stakeholders to identify learning and development needs and design learning solutions that align with business goals.
  • Design and develop interactive and multi-media-rich eLearning courses, videos, simulations, and other digital learning materials.
  • Utilize the client's learning management system, WorkRamp, and other technologies to deliver and track completion, adoption, and impact of learning programs.
  • Manage the complete content development cycle, including creation, ongoing updates, and continuous evaluation for your projects to drive adoption of compelling and engaging learning experiences.
  • Provide input and guidance on global L&D strategy delivery roadmap.
  • Evaluate and recommend innovative learning technologies and tools to enhance learning experiences.
  • Establish and regularly report on baseline metrics for learning engagement, program adoption, and ROI.

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Instructional Design, Educational Technology, or related field. Master’s degree preferred.
  • 8+ years of experience in instructional design, with a focus on learning technology.
  • Proficiency in eLearning authoring tools (Articulate Storyline, Adobe Captivate) and learning management systems. Experience with WorkRamp preferred.
  • Strong knowledge of instructional design principles and adult learning theories.
  • Experience designing programs with blended learning, micro-learning, and other innovative learning methodologies.
  • Familiarity with SCORM standards.
  • Experience in graphic design, video production, or multimedia development.
  • Excellent project management skills and 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ills.
